How to Fix a Water Damage Bathroom
Water damage frequently takes place in the bathroom due to the water made use of everyday. Occasionally, the damages could be a little mold from the shower. Various other times, it's massive damages on your floor. Whatever it is, it is always great to recognize the cause as well as stop it prior to it happens.
This guide will certainly experience some of the typical sources of water damage in the bathroom. We will likewise examine what you can do to avoid these reasons from harming your washroom. Let's dive in.
These are the typical factors you would certainly have water damage in your bathrooms as well as just how you can spot them:

Excess Moisture


It's amazing to have that lengthy shower and splash water while you dance around and also imitate you're performing, however often these acts might create water damage to your washroom.
Splashing water around can create water to head to edges and form molds. View exactly how you spread excess wetness around, as well as when you do it, clean it up to avoid damages.

Fractures in your wall surface floor tiles


Washroom wall surface floor tiles have actually been specially created for that function. They safeguard the wall from wetness from individuals taking showers. Nevertheless, they are not undestroyable.
Occasionally, your washroom wall surface tiles crack and allow some moisture to seep into the wall. This could potentially destroy the wall if you do not take any kind of activity. If you notice a crack on your wall surface floor tiles, repair it promptly. Do not wait up until it destroys your wall.

Overruning commodes and also sinks


As people, in some cases we make mistakes that could create some water damage in the washroom. As an example, leaving your sink tap on could trigger overflowing and also damages to various other parts of the shower room with wetness.
Also, a faulty toilet can create overruning. For instance, a broken toilet take care of or various other parts of the tank. When this occurs, it could harm the flooring.
As soon as you notice an overruning sink or bathroom, call a plumbing professional to aid handle it instantly.

Ruptured or Dripping Pipes


There are several pipelines carrying water to various parts of your shower room. Some pipes take water to the commode, the sink, the taps, the shower, and several other places. They crisscross the small area of the washroom.
Occasionally, these pipes could obtain rustic and ruptured. Other times, human action can cause them to leakage. When this occurs, you'll find water in the edges of your shower room or on the wall.
To detect this, watch out for bubbling wall surfaces, molds, or mold. Call a professional emergency situation plumbing to repair this when it takes place.

Roofing system Leakages


In some cases, the trouble of water damage to the bathroom may not come from the shower room. As an example, a roofing leakage might create damage to the shower room ceiling. You can spot the damages done by looking at the water spots on the ceiling.
If you locate water discolorations on your ceiling, check the roofing to see if it's damaged. Then, call an expert to help resolve the concern.

What are the common causes of water damage?


Life just isn’t possible without water. But for all its life-giving benefits, water can also be a very destructive force of nature. If you rank all the potential disasters that could hit your property, water damage will stand a very good chance of taking the top spot.



Water damage affects buildings on so many levels. When water creeps into areas of your property where it shouldn’t be, your floor could warp. Water damage also discolors beautifully painted walls. All that moisture can also lead not only to the formation of mold inside the building but also to a vermin infestation. Worst of all, water damage that isn’t immediately addressed through water damage restoration could eventually weaken the foundation of any building.



Water damage is also deceptively costly. You might think that an inch or two of water flooding your home or business wouldn’t burn a hole in your pocket, but there have been cases where that little amount of water has caused damage that cost tens of thousands of dollars to repair and restore.



The worst thing about water damage is that it can happen at any time. Let’s take a look at some of the common causes of water damage.


Severe weather


Thunderstorms, hurricanes, and other natural disasters don’t happen every day, but when they do, there’ll always be the risk of water damage striking your property.



The strong winds and heavy downpour could damage your roof, sending a certain amount of rainwater straight down into your house or business. Worse, severe weather can sometimes lead to flash flooding, especially when your property is in a flood-prone area.


Clogged gutters


Your home’s gutter system is supposed to draw rainwater away from your house. However, gutters often get blocked by leaves, branches, and other types of debris over time. When that happens, rainwater won’t be able to flow properly away from your property and will instead overflow the edges of your gutters, run down the side of the house, and cause water damage on the ceiling, walls, and floors.


Leaking pipes


A loose-fitting pipe in the kitchen sink could leak enough water to damage the cabinet underneath it. A broken pipe inside walls could make things even more complicated. The water damage such a leak can cause would be huge, as the entire wall would be water damaged, and it’ll foster the formation of an entire colony of mold.



Worse yet would be a leaking plumbing supply line or a drainage pipe in the soil underneath your concrete slab. When this happens, you’ll likely face costly repairs.


Washing machine water supply line leak


Your washing machine is fed by water supply lines that are under constant pressure. If your lines are made from braided stainless steel, then you have nothing to worry about. The problem will be if your washing machine has rubber or PVC supply lines. They can easily wear out and rupture, which means your entire laundry room will be flooded in minutes if you don’t shut off the water source in time.
